The Allure of Free Money: Understanding No Deposit Bonuses

No deposit bonuses typically come in two forms: a set amount of bonus cash or free spins on selected slot games. The appeal lies in the opportunity to win real money without any financial risk. However, understanding the terms and conditions associated with these bonuses is crucial to gauge their actual value.

The Math Behind No Deposit Bonuses

No deposit bonuses are not simply a gift from casinos; they are calculated risks for operators. Here’s a breakdown of the common metrics involved:

  • Return to Player (RTP): Typically ranges from 85% to 98%. The higher the RTP, the better the odds for players.
  • Wagering Requirements: Commonly set at 30x to 50x the bonus amount. For example, if you receive a £10 bonus with a 35x requirement, you must wager £350 before you can withdraw any winnings.
  • Withdrawal Limits: Many casinos impose a cap on the maximum amount you can withdraw from winnings accrued from no deposit bonuses, often ranging from £50 to £100.

Deciphering the Terms: What to Look For

Before claiming a no deposit bonus, scrutinize the terms and conditions. Key factors include:

  • Expiration Dates: Bonuses often come with a limited validity period, usually between 7 to 30 days.
  • Eligible Games: Certain bonuses apply only to specific games, which can limit your options significantly.
  • Geographic Restrictions: Some bonuses may not be available in your region due to local gambling regulations.

Hidden Risks Associated with No Deposit Bonuses

While no deposit bonuses can be enticing, they come with hidden risks:

  • High Wagering Requirements: As highlighted, a 50x wagering requirement can render the bonus nearly useless, especially for low-stakes players.
  • Limited Game Selection: Many bonuses restrict you to specific games that may not yield favorable odds.
  • Account Verification: Casinos often require complete account verification before allowing withdrawals, which can be a tedious process.
